Australian HR Institute (AHRI)
Michelle Collett (MAHRI) currently serves as the Research & Advocacy Coordinator and 2023 AHRI Awards Coordinator at the Australian HR Institute (AHRI), where efforts focus on recognizing excellence in the HR profession. With extensive experience in learning and development, Michelle has previously held roles such as Learning and Development Advisor at City West Water and Learning and Development Coordinator at Hobsons Bay City Council, among others. Involvement in professional organizations includes serving as Co-Convenor of the Learning and Development Special Interest Group at LGPro VIC. Michelle's academic background includes a Diploma in Training Design and Development from RMIT University, a Post Graduate Diploma in Business (Human Resource Management) from Swinburne University of Technology, and a Certificate IV in Training and Assessment from VECCI.
Australian HR Institute (AHRI)
The Australian HR Institute (AHRI) is the national association representing human resource and people management professionals. We have around 20,000 members from Australia and across the globe. AHRI provides education and training services in HR, people management and business skills; produces world-class conferences; and holds seminars and networking opportunities all over Australia – including our biggest annual event – the AHRI National Convention. AHRI also sets standards through accreditation of HR qualifications at universities across Australia, conducts research into people management practices, and assists governments in the development of policy and legislation that affects people at work. AHRI is owned by its members and governed by a Board of Directors with a Council of State Presidents that comprises an elected president representing each state and territory of Australia. AHRI acknowledges the HR experience of its members with a member certification program and commends excellence in HR practice across Australia through a number of awards programs.
